Alternator Ground - Best location?

reetings all,

I've appreciated all the information and wisdom on this board over the years.

Recently I've used it to help figure out the best way to upgrade systems prior to adding solar and Lithium Batteries.
I am ready to start the installation of a 150A Balmar Alternator, Regulator and Pulley Kit along with a Victron Orion DC to DC charger for the starter battery.

I will upgrade wiring, add fuses, and eliminate the old Battery combiner and the Digital Echo Charge.
I plan to wire directly to the House batteries from the alternator.

Where should I run this ground to?
The ground from the Alternator is undersized so I will upgrade this as well. It currently runs to a ground point, along with some other connection on the engine block about 16" away. Then a larger wire runs to a Ground block near the battery switches and then it connects to the ground switch where it also connects to the house bank ground here.

It seems like there are a few options:
1 - Stay on the engine block terminal
2 - Go to the House bank ground terminal on the Shunt about 5' away?
3 - Go to the ground black about 15' away?

What do you suggest for best performance and safety?

I spent hours today chasing and following wires to understand the system and I think this is the last question to answer before digging into the installation. Any other advice on the project is welcomed!

Re: Alternator Ground - Best location?

I think sharing a single large engine ground (battery negative to block, starter, alternator, instruments, ect) is a electrically reasonable and cost / resource effective solution. Using a single shared conductor is done all over electrical/ electronic systems (circuit board traces and wire). There are cases where this is a bad idea but not typically.

Size it according to starter requirements. Modern alternator controllers typically don't even start ramping up the current until long after stsrting.

Re: Alternator Ground - Best location?

OP:
I disagree with @Frankly Post #2: The starter is a load and it is the only circuit on board that is not required to be fused. The alternator, on the other hand is a source and its output is required to be fused at the battery. Therefore, Option 2 is the best option.

Ensure that the alternator B- is properly sized and is landed on the low side (system side) of the shunt. Only the B- from your house battery bank will be landed on the high side (battery side) of the shunt.

The circuit protection is for the wire with the battery being the source. The alternator being in essence a regulated voltage output limited current source should not need any circuit protection if the wire is correctly sized.

200A fuse (located near the battery) is not uncommon.

I took my own advice. Here's what Balmar stipulates for their alternator installations:

GROUNDING
Alternator models designated as Isolated Ground (IG) feature an independent ground terminal that’s isolated from the alternator case. Isolated Ground alternators are used in applications where the engine is not desired to be a part of the grounding system. This is commonplace in steel or aluminum hull boats, or with engines that depend on sophisticated electronic ignition systems. In other applications, isolated grounding simply ensures that the alternator is sufficiently connected to system ground. The alternator’s ground cable should be the same size as the alternator’s positive output cable.

FUSING
The American Boat and Yacht Council (ABYC), in its standards for safer boating, recommends that cable runs to your battery banks be fused to protect the boat and owner against damage and injury. Circuit protection, as described by ABYC standards, can be accomplished by installing either a resettable circuit breaker or a fuse. The fuse or breaker you choose will depend on both the amperage rating of the alternator and the size of cable used. The following considerations can be used to determine fusing:
  1. The largest available circuit protection device smaller than the amperage capacity of the cable being protected.
  2. Larger than the maximum continuous current that will flow in the circuit. We find that a circuit protection device sized at approximately 140% of your alternator’s rated amperage is typically suitable for the circuit being protected. For more info about circuit fusing, see http://circuitwizzard.bluesea.com
So according to Balmar 200-amp fusing is just about right (it's a little less than 140%).
